corduroy


Question Posted Friday April 1 2005, 11:49 am

i am VERY short, so whenever i buy jeans, i cut them to fit my length (instead of hemming them), cause i dont care about the little freys at the bottom. But yesterday i bought corduroy pants that are of course too long, if i cut them, would that ruin them?

ballerina04 answered Friday April 1 2005, 1:35 pm:
You should probably hem them instead. Corduroy is different than denim, and you never know what's going to happen.

DangerNerd answered Friday April 1 2005, 12:07 pm:
If it is within your power to hem them, I would advise it. Cords aren't denim and the way the fabric comes apart is not flattering at all. I had a jacket come apart after an accidental tear, once it starts you can't stop it, if I recall correctly. It was years ago, I was a kid and it was the 70s, when cords were in last time. ;-)
